Demand Planner

Mativ is a global leader in specialty materials headquartered in Alpharetta, Georgia. The Company offers a wide range of critical components and engineered solutions that connect, protect, and purify our world.


The Demand Planner is responsible for supporting the demand planning process by developing, analyzing, and maintaining demand forecasts. This role works cross-functionally with Sales, Marketing, Finance, and Supply Chain teams to ensure accurate, data-driven forecasts that enable effective production and inventory planning.

The position provides foundational exposure to Sales & Operations Planning (S&OP), statistical forecasting, and demand analytics, while building strong business and analytical skills.



Key Responsibilities

  • Develop and maintain the demand forecast using statistical models, customer forecasts, analytics, and input from sales, marketing, finance, and supply chain.
  • Create SKU-level forecasts within the KetteQ demand planning system and partner with supply chain teams to maintain any constraints.
  • Conduct scenario planning with the business teams and recommended actions to meet service and shipment goals.
  • Partner with the senior demand planner to improve the quality of the statistical forecast for the purpose of improving the accuracy and efficiency of the forecast.
  • Support monthly S&OP / demand planning cycle activities
  • Prepare data inputs for demand review meetings
  • Analyze historical sales, trends, and demand variability
  • Leverage forecast KPIs such as MAPE, Bias, and general accuracy targets to improve the demand forecast.
  • Support process improvement initiatives



Qualifications

Bachelor of Business Administration, Supply Chain Management, Finance, or Analytics preferred

Understanding of demand planning methods and supply chain processes

Proficiency in Microsoft Excel

Self-motivated with a high level of personal drive

Strong organizational and communication skills.
